Group F deserved the title of group death in the group stage of the Champions League, which was withdrawn today in the Principality of Monaco of France.

The group included Barcelona, ​​Dortmund, Inter Milan and Slavia Prague.

Group A: Paris St Germain, Real Madrid, Belgian Club Bruges and Galatasaray.

Group B: Bayern Munich, Tottenham Hotspur, Greek Olympiakos and Serbian Red Star

Group C: Manchester City, Ukraine's Shakhtar, Croatia's Dinamo Zagreb and Italy's Atlanta.

Group D: Juventus, Atletico Madrid, Bayer Leverkusen and Lokomotiv Moscow

Group E: Liverpool, Napoli, Red Bull Salzburg, Austria and Genk.

Group F: Barcelona, ​​Borussia Dortmund, Inter Milan, Slavia Prague

Group G: Zenit St Petersburg, Benfica, Lyon, Leipzig

Group H: Chelsea, Ajax, Valencia and Lille
